Abstract

The rising overheads of data-movement and limitations of general-purpose processing architectures have led to a huge surge in the interest in “processing-in-memory” (PIM) approach and “neural networks” (NN) architectures. Spintronic memories facilitate efficient implementation of PIM approach and NN accelerators, and offer several advantages over conventional memories. In this paper, we present a survey of spintronic-architectures for PIM and NNs. We organize the works based on main attributes to underscore their similarities and differences. This paper will be useful for researchers in the area of artificial intelligence, hardware architecture, chip design and memory system.
